Default 30,000 mile service for '05 Pilot

Dealer is quoting me about $450 for the 30,000 mile service on my 2005 Pilot. The rear diff inspection is included. This seems really high to me. Any thoughts would be much appreciated.

Make sure you ask for the specific things identified in the owner's manual due at 30k. ie VTM-4 fluid change, oil change, tire rotation, etc. Do NOT ask for the dealerships "30k service" which will add on hundreds of dollars of unnecessary items.

Hit the local auto parts store for an air filter and cabin filter and do those yourself. Plenty of "DIY" guides on this site to assist.

This has been covered before here but 30k should include:

Oil (if due) $20
Tire rotation (if due) $20
VTM-4 fluid change $50-$80
Cabin air filter $15-$20 DIY, takes 30 min first time and 10 after that OR $100 at dealer
Engine filter $15 or so DYI, takes 5 min

Total low: $130
Total high: $255
